Former New Jersey Senator Dick LaRossa will be addressing the 912 Project on several important topics, 2011 Elections and the New Jersey Supreme Court. He will be talking about the impact of the New Jersey Supreme Court on the school funding formula. The fact that it is the New Jersey Supreme Court that determines how the school funding formula is developed, and not the state legislature, is of critical importance in understanding how the funds are then distributed to the multiple school districts throughout the state. The outcomes of elections influence the selection of Supreme Court justices. And it is this intersection of citizen involvement by voting that makes the election process and the school funding formula items of both interest and importance.

does Sarah Palin have to take out a full page ad in the New York Times before people will realize why she is not going to CPAC?
The Iron Dog Race Banquet and Drawing for starting times is on the same day as CPAC. She is naturally going to be at the Banquet with her husband, Todd Palin, 5-time winner of the Iron Dog Race.
